ID/Back reference text positioning, drawing title

Can anyone tell me how to change the text positioning of the drawing ID and back reference within the Linear drawing title? Ie. centered horizontally in the circle (see attached screenshot)

 

It only appears to be an issue when back referencing another view. I can overwrite this by showing a custom ID but then it is not truly back referencing properly, also I don't understand why that makes a difference to the text positioning.

 

The only text positioning options I can find are greyed out, I don't even know if they are the setting I'm looking for.

Hi @Archie06 

Try selecting the title and clicking the magenta dot to move it.
